Formation of ultracold $^{39}$K$^{133}$Cs Feshbach molecules

We report the creation of an ultracold gas of bosonic $^{39}$K$^{133}$Cs molecules. We first demonstrate a cooling strategy relying on sympathetic cooling of $^{133}$Cs to produce an ultracold mixture. From this mixture, weakly bound molecules are formed using a Feshbach resonance at 361.7 G. The molecular gas contains $7.6(10)\times 10^3$ molecules with a lifetime of about 130 ms, limited by two-body decay. We perform Feshbach spectroscopy to observe several new interspecies resonances and characterize the bound state used for magnetoassociation. Finally, we fit the combined results to obtain improved K-Cs interaction potentials. This provides a good starting point for the creation of ultracold samples of ground-state $^{39}$K$^{133}$Cs molecules.
